FOB Origin Pricing
A pricing term indicating that the buyer is responsible for freight costs and assumes risk for the goods once they leave the seller's premises.
Uniform Delivered Pricing
The price the seller quotes that includes all transportation costs.
Transportation Costs
Expenses associated with the process of moving goods or materials from one location to another.
Hi-Lo Pricing
A retail pricing strategy where prices are regularly discounted from higher listed prices, creating a sense of value and urgency among consumers.
